If I may interject, here's the result of a quick qrep: ./rk3399pro-rock-pi-n10.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i N10"; ./rk3399-rock-pi-4a-plus.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i 4A+"; ./rk3588s-rock-5a.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K 5 Model A"; ./rk3588-rock-5b.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K 5 Model B"; ./rk3399-rock-4c-plus.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K 4C+"; ./rk3399-rock-pi-4b-plus.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i 4B+"; ./rk3399-rock-pi-4b.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i 4B"; ./rk3399-rock-pi-4c.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i 4C"; ./rk3308-rock-pi-s.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i S"; ./rk3399-rock-pi-4a.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i 4A"; ./rk3399-rock-4se.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K 4SE"; ./rk3328-rock-pi-e.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K Pi E"; ./rk3568-rock-3a.dts: model = "Radxa ROCK3 Model A"; Based on that, I think that "Radxa ROCK 3 Model C" would actually be the preferred name... Perhaps? If we end up following that approach, the last board dts on the list above should also be fixed to read "Radxa ROCK 3 Model A".
